Mauritius vs Thailand: tax rates compared

Thailand's income tax rate is 15pp higher than Mauritius's (35% vs 20%). The 200-country average is 28%: Mauritius sits below it, Thailand sits above it. Mauritius's figure is dated 2025-07-01 and Thailand's 2026-02-02, so the two rates come from different data vintages.

Verified data covers five of the six tracked tax types for both countries; every rate below is cited to its source and dated.

Thailand's corporate tax rate is 5pp higher than Mauritius's (20% vs 15%). The 201-country average is 22.6%: both sit below it.

Mauritius's VAT rate is 8pp higher than Thailand's (15% vs 7%). The 181-country average is 15%: Mauritius matches the world average, Thailand sits below it.

Mauritius's capital gains tax rate is identical to Thailand's — both sit at 0%. The 175-country average is 10.3%: both sit below it.
